Advertising : 46 wordsSupported by heavy tanks, American infantrymen race across an open field as they push toward the enemy-held village of Dombasle, in north-eastern France. They are part of the U.S. 3rd Army which since early this month has been breaking down the defences guarding the fortress of Mets, key to the Saar region.—U.S. O.W.I. photo. ... [ILLUSTRATED]
